Skip to content

Conversation

goruha
Copy link
Member

@goruha goruha commented Aug 14, 2025

port #198 Parameterize access policies json for more flexibility (3rd try)

what

Adds a new parameter to be able to pass a json string with a custom access policy to set for the elasticsearch.

why

In my opinion, the access policies are too "opinionated" on this module, especially when it is on "vpc mode". I think it should be more flexible and allow to customize it however we want and not having it based on the iam_role_arn variable.

references

N/A

P.S.: This is already the 3rd time I'm trying to have this new parameter accepted. Please take a look at it this time 🙇 thank you.
Previous tries:

@goruha goruha requested review from a team as code owners August 14, 2025 15:53
@goruha goruha requested review from hans-d and kevcube August 14, 2025 15:53
@mergify mergify bot added the triage Needs triage label Aug 14, 2025
@goruha
Copy link
Member Author

goruha commented Aug 14, 2025

/terratest

@mergify mergify bot removed the triage Needs triage label Aug 14, 2025
@goruha goruha merged commit 4c1bb3b into main Aug 14, 2025
34 checks passed
@goruha goruha deleted the bmbferreira-master branch August 14, 2025 17:48
Copy link
Contributor

These changes were released in v1.2.0.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ants